Cybersecurity on a budget: Affordable cloud security tools for SMBs

Small and medium-sized businesses (SMBs) are increasingly targeted by cyber threats due to their growing digital presence, valuable data assets, and often limited security infrastructure. While cloud adoption offers operational flexibility and scalability, it also expands the attack surface, making cybersecurity a critical priority. However, budget constraints frequently prevent SMBs from investing in enterprise-grade security solutions. This paper explores practical, cost-effective strategies and cloud-based security tools that enable SMBs to strengthen their cybersecurity posture without exceeding financial limits. The proposed approach focuses on leveraging affordable, subscription-based, and scalable cloud security services that provide enterprise-level protection at SMB-friendly pricing. Core recommendations include deploying cloud-native security tools such as managed firewalls, intrusion detection and prevention systems, secure web gateways, and endpoint protection platforms offered by reputable cloud providers. Multi-factor authentication, identity and access management solutions, and automated patch management are highlighted as high-impact, low-cost measures for reducing risk. The research also examines the benefits of adopting open-source security tools integrated with cloud environments, enabling SMBs to achieve robust monitoring, threat detection, and incident response capabilities without substantial licensing fees. Emphasis is placed on shared responsibility models, helping SMBs understand which security functions are handled by the cloud service provider and which remain their obligation. Case examples illustrate how SMBs have implemented affordable cloud security solutions such as AWS Guard Duty, Microsoft Defender for Cloud, and Google Chronicle to reduce phishing incidents, detect anomalous behaviour, and maintain compliance with industry standards. The findings underscore that effective cybersecurity on a budget is achievable by prioritizing risk-based investment, consolidating security functions into integrated platforms, and using automation to offset staffing limitations. Ultimately, the study positions affordable cloud security not as a compromise but as a strategic enabler for SMB resilience. With the right mix of low-cost tools, best practices, and informed governance, SMBs can significantly enhance threat protection, safeguard customer trust, and support secure digital growth.
